Step 4 of the Nightglass migration: replace the ad-hoc backfill scripts with the Ferrow scheduler. Register each nightly backfill as a named task, keeping the existing UTC windows so downstream jobs at Calder Analytics are unaffected. Retries are handled by the scheduler; remove any retry loops from the scripts themselves. The scheduler reads its runtime settings from the block below.

config for kafof-bawef:
holath:
  log_level: debug
  metrics_host: metrics.holath.qorvelsys.internal
  pin: 2191
  pool_size: 32

Ticket: Staging env misconfigured for Siftgate bloom filter

The bloom layer in front of the Pellet KV store is rejecting all lookups in staging because the env file was copied from the dev template without credentials. False-positive tuning values are fine; only the auth line is missing. To unblock the weekly demo, the Pellet admission secret must be set on the following line.

env line for yaguf-fajop: LEDGER_TOKEN13=fb08984397349

## Service Accounts — BloomGate Filter

BloomGate sits in front of the Corvel key-value store and rejects lookups for keys that definitely don't exist, sparing Corvel roughly 60% of read traffic. The filter is rebuilt nightly by the svc-bloomgate account, which needs read access to Corvel's snapshot export and write access to the filter bucket. Rebuilds must not overlap with compaction windows. The account authenticates to the internal SnapFeed API with the key below.

gateway credential: kto3_qfe